7.1
Approval of DDA
with Regis Homes of Northern California, for the development of residential
units at 320 North First Street and acceptance of the 33433 Summary Report and
Re-Use Appraisal.
Recommendation:
Adoption of Resolutions:
(a) By the City Council
approving the disposition of the real property located at 320 North First
Street (APN 249-44-101) to Regis Homes of Northern California, accepting the
33433 Summary Report and Re-Use Appraisal, and finding that the disposition of
the property will assist in the elimination of blight, is consistent with the
13th Street SNI Redevelopment Project Area objectives and that the
consideration for the property is not less than the fair reuse value for the
proposed use, with the covenants and conditions and development costs
authorized by the Disposition and Development Agreement (DDA); and,
(b) By the Agency Board
approving the DDA and authorizing the Executive Director to execute ancillary
documents contemplated by the DDA and to close escrow and convey the Property
subject to compliance with the terms of the DDA, and to negotiate and execute
amendments to the DDA substantially in conformance with the intent of the DDA
as reasonably necessary.
CEQA: Resolution No. 68839 PDC02-077 [SNI: 13th Street]
Documents Filed: Memorandum from Redevelopment Agency Executive Director Susan Shick, dated April 29, 2003, recommending adoption of said resolutions.
Discussion/Action: Upon motion by Council Member Chavez, seconded by Council Member Cortese and unanimously carried, Resolution No. 71539, entitled: “A Resolution of the Council of the City of San José Approving the Disposition of a Portion of the Real Property Located at 320 North First Street (APN 249-44-101) to Regis Homes of Northern California; Accepting the 33433 Summary Report and Re-Use Appraisal; and Making Certain Findings”, and Redevelopment Agency Resolution No. 5403, were adopted. Mayor Gonzales abstained because of a conflict of interest in the property. Vote: 10-0-0-1. Disqualified: Gonzales.
